Do you ever need to find the contact information for either a person or a property address? If so, I've got two great resources. The first one, it's completely free. It's called Truepeoplesearch.com.


Check it out. It pulls a ton of data. You can search by the name of the person or by the actual address, and it'll pull up some really good contact info and it's free.


If you strike out there, the next option I got for you is called Title Toolbox. It's offered by me here at Chicago Title. I can sign you up with a free account.


You can pull data on any type of property from a single-family residential home to a bowling alley, to commercial, to anything... Anywhere within the United States.
